basically I am talking about a near stock length track bar that uses the stock axle mount and a double shear frame mount that sets about 1.5" lower than the stock mount
and then using stock steering...
how bad would bump steer be in this case
I know many people do this and lots of people get the nice track bar... but do not address the steering angles or vice versa... but then again some people run 38s on a D35...
